Trabajar con tablas y archivos relacionados > Búsquedas
 
Búsquedas
Una búsqueda copia los datos de otra tabla en un campo de la tabla actual. Una vez copiados los datos, éstos forman parte de la tabla actual (y permanecen a su vez en la tabla desde la que se copiaron). Los datos copiados en la tabla actual no cambian automáticamente cuando cambian los datos de la otra tabla.
Para establecer una conexión entre las tablas para realizar una actualización, debe crear una relación. A continuación, defina una búsqueda para copiar los datos de un campo de la tabla relacionada a un campo de la tabla actual.
Cuando escribe o cambia un valor en el campo coincidente de la tabla actual, FileMaker Pro utiliza la relación para acceder al primer registro de la tabla relacionada cuyo campo coincidente contenga un valor coincidente. Después, copia el valor del campo de origen de la búsqueda al campo de destino de la búsqueda, en donde se almacena el valor.
Después de copiar un valor en el campo de destino de la búsqueda, puede editarlo, reemplazarlo o eliminarlo como cualquier otro valor (ya que el valor de la búsqueda pertenece ahora a la tabla actual). También puede actualizar los datos de la tabla actual para hacerlos coincidir con los datos que cambien en la tabla relacionada.
Utilice las actualizaciones para:
Copiar datos desde una tabla relacionada (que puede ser la misma tabla) y conservarlos tal como se han copiado, aunque cambien los datos de la tabla relacionada. Por ejemplo, puede utilizar una actualización para copiar el precio de un artículo en el momento de la compra en una tabla Factura. Aunque cambie el precio en la tabla relacionada, el precio de la tabla Factura sigue siendo el mismo.
Mantener tablas que ya contienen actualizaciones, cuando no quiera cambiar las tablas a una base de datos relacional.
Notas
Cuando exista el mismo valor en el campo coincidente en más de un registro de la tabla relacionada:
Se copia el valor del primer registro relacionado creado si la relación no tiene un tipo de ordenación.
Se copia el valor del primer registro del tipo de ordenación si la relación tiene un tipo de ordenación.
Si cambia los datos en el campo coincidente de la tabla relacionada o en el campo de origen de la búsqueda para realizar una búsqueda, FileMaker Pro no actualizará automáticamente los datos en el campo de destino de la búsqueda. Para actualizar los datos, debe volver a buscarlos. Esto ocurre cuando el valor del campo coincidente cambia en la tabla de destino de la búsqueda, lo que hace que FileMaker Pro ejecute una nueva búsqueda.
Temas relacionados 
Relaciones